Diamond Jubilee Garden, London

Diamond Jubilee Garden is a quiet pocket of calm tucked into Covent Garden, a place where the city briefly softens.

Set beside St. Paul's Church just off Bedford Street and steps from the Covent Garden piazza, this small garden sits in one of London's most visited areas, yet feels slightly removed the moment you step inside, the transition is immediate, outside, performers, crowds, and constant motion, inside, greenery, benches, and open space create a subtle but noticeable shift in pace, it's not expansive, but it offers just enough breathing room to feel like a reset within the density.

Diamond Jubilee Garden reflects the quieter, more local layer of Covent Garden, existing alongside the area's commercial and cultural energy.

Located next to St. Paul's Church, often referred to as the β€œActors' Church,” the garden carries a subtle connection to the theatre world that surrounds it, what defines the space is its simplicity, it's not designed as a major attraction, but as a functional green space for pause, conversation, and brief escape, this contrast is what gives it value, surrounded by one of London's busiest districts, it operates on a completely different rhythm, offering calm without requiring distance.
